Announcement of New President and CEO

The Board of Directors of Vantage Engineering Inc. are pleased to announce that Ian M. Squires,
P. Eng., has been selected as the Company’s President and CEO.

Ian has more than 17 years of multi-disciplinary experience in facilities and gathering system optimization and upgrading, production operations, project engineering and execution as well as business management. Ian has been Vice President of the Company since 2008, his experience and leadership will help further the company’s vision of being the most sought after provider of oil and gas facilities engineering services in Western Canada.

Robert B. Ramsay, P. Eng. will remain active with the Company in a technical specialist role.

Vantage Safety & Ethics – Environmental, Health and Safety Protection

Vantage Engineering Inc. places a strong emphasis on health, safety and environmental protection. We can implement stand-alone procedures or can develop client specific controls to be integrated into our clients own programs to ensure they meet and, where possible, exceed prevailing regulatory requirements.

As an engineering firm we are legally bound by APEGGA’s Code of Ethics and follow the APEGGA “Guideline for Ethical Practice”, the APEGGA “Guideline for Environmental Practice” and the APEGGA guideline for “Basic Learnings in Industrial Safety and Loss Management” as well as the Alberta Occupational Health and Safety Act.

Our corporate mission is to provide socially and environmentally responsible solutions to the oil and gas sector and we always strive to exceed governing regulations. We believe acting responsibly to protect the health and safety of our employees and the general public is not merely a choice, but is in fact, an absolute necessity. Maintaining a healthy workplace, operating safely and protecting the environment are the responsibility of every Vantage staff member and both they and our contractors take that responsibility very seriously.

Our staff and our contractors are well versed on established standards and performance expectations. Site managers ensure staff and contractors are competent to perform their work safely, are aware of environmental, health and safety hazards and comply with appropriate safe operating practices. In addition to monitoring on-site performance, trained personnel are available to deal with unplanned events in order to minimize potential risks to staff, local residents and the environment.

Ultimately:

  • We conduct our operations in a manner that protects the health and safety of our employees, contractors and the public.
  • We comply with the intent and specific requirements of all health and safety laws and regulations. Compliance with the law and Vantage’s policies and practices are the responsibility of every worker (employees and contractors) and is a condition of employment.
  • We do not knowingly place workers or the public at risk and will not support any decision that compromises safety for the sake of any other business objective. Workers are expected to take action on any unsafe conditions.
  • We provide, and all staff are expected to complete, the training needed to operate in a safe and healthy manner.
  • We maintain effective emergency response procedures, train staff in their use and conduct simulated emergencies to test the effectiveness of established plans.
  • We regularly review safety and loss performance, conduct safety audits and share those results with staff and contractors in order to identify strengths and opportunities for improvement.
  • We continue to evaluate and improve policies and operating practices taking into account changes in laws and regulations, technical developments, industry standards and Vantage’s operations.
  • We are diligent in immediately reporting any situation that could impact the public to the appropriate regulatory agency and cooperate fully with them. We will be partners with the regulators and the affected communities in keeping the public informed and bringing the situation or emergency to a satisfactory conclusion.

The Engineering, Geological and Geophysical Professions Act
Code of Ethics

Professional engineers, geologists and geophysicists shall recognize that professional ethics is founded upon integrity, competence, dignity and devotion to service. This concept shall guide their conduct at all times.

Rules of Conduct:

  1. Professional engineers, geologists and geophysicists shall, in their areas of practice, hold paramount the health, safety and welfare of the public and have regard for the environment.
  2. Professional engineers, geologists and geophysicists shall undertake only work that they are competent to perform by virtue of their training and experience.
  3. Professional engineers, geologists and geophysicists shall conduct themselves with integrity, honesty, fairness and objectivity in their professional activities.
  4. Professional engineers, geologists and geophysicists shall comply with applicable statues, regulations and bylaws in their professional practices.
  5. Professional engineers, geologists and geophysicists shall uphold and enhance the honour, dignity and reputation of their professions and thus the ability of the professions to serve the public interest.

This Code of Ethics is supplemented by the document “Guidelines for Ethical Practice” published by APEGGA, and available at www.apegga.ca/pdf/Guidelines/02.pdf
